Position Summary   
The Nurse RN role will work to administer vaccines (flu, covid, MMR etc). PPE is provided.
We are looking for nurses who:
•Lead with heart –display empathy and compassion for their patients, customers, caregivers and colleagues on your team
•Adapt to change and adjust plans to thrive in a dynamic community healthcare setting
•Collaborate with others and actively contribute to a team culture that promotes caring, energy, enthusiasm and pride.
•Professionally interact with health care professionals and patients
•Possess strong clinical skills including: medication administration, the ability and willingness to vaccinate patients, BLS (Basic Life Saving) certification

Education   
Minimum Qualifications
•Full, active and unrestricted license as a registered nurse in a state, territory or commonwealth of the United States or District of Columbia. At least one year related nursing experience to include immunizing and providing quality care to patients.
